Copy Editor
We are currently seeking Copy Editors to support our Federal client with reviewing finished intelligence papers prior to publication and dissemination. This role requires 100% on-site support in Washington, DC.
What you will be doing:
- Recommending edits to draft papers, graphics, and other products to improve quality and ensure products are editorially correct without altering technical accuracy or meaning
- Ensuring products conform to client's policy guidance and style standards
- Applying writing standards, critical thinking skills, and expertise in grammar, punctuation, and copyediting to identify and resolve editorial issues and inconsistencies in complex text and graphics
- Revising corporate style guidance as necessary
- Developing and recommending editorial and publishing policies and practices along with standard operation procedures for editing and/or publishing
What you need to be considered for this role (required): - Bachelor's Degree or higher from an accredited college or university in in English, writing, or a related field (years of experience may be accepted in lieu of a degree)
- 2-6 years of copyediting experience
- Experience reviewing written products for grammar, punctuation, spelling, and adherence to style guidelines
- Experience performing copyedit reviews of intelligence products, including classification portion markings and endnotes
- Knowledge of Intelligence Community agency/office style guides
